returns, some of his financial documents. now that s the center of two cases that have just come to the supreme court. donald trump lost, now he s coming to the justices with broad claims of immunity. the first case comes out of new york, where a new york district attorney was looking into hush money, and he decided to send a subpoena to the president s long-time accounting firm for his tax returns. the president s private lawyers rushed to court and tried to block that. they lost below, and they re coming to the supreme court. there s another case, too, that might have bigger implications than that one. that s because the house is involved. the house had been investigating some of the president s financial disclosures, and they also subpoenaed the third party accounting firm, and the president again fought to stop it and he lost. the reason that second case is so important is it really looks
